I had a temp controller malfunction and it got my ferment room / wine cellar up to 87 degrees. I have nothing fermenting but I do have bottled wine stored in there..... did I do any damage? I have no idea how long but no more than just today.
 
If your wine was in a rack out of sunlight 66-72F since corking I am guessing each bottle still held no more than 78 F. Temps vary 3 ° from 6" to 36" from ground level. If 24hrs. was the max I think you will be good,
